Planning area 01

Decisions to make for food broker software

  • For food broker, define participant roles, verification and listing rules.
  • Confirm how food broker users will handle search, enquiry, matching and moderation steps.
  • List the food broker rules for payments, commissions, disputes and content ownership.
  • Test a rejected listing, disputed transaction or unavailable provider against a real food broker exception.
